Output 313fd8bd86f8342300c9fd7fa40ea181d53ea06c9ddf7f35b2c936f34c74ef3b:0

value
339288249
script pubkey
OP_0 OP_PUSHBYTES_20 3d70823b9f17af690b41b5a3fba17fdec8b74884
address
bc1q84cgywulz7hkjz6pkk3lhgtlmmytwjyynqx346
transaction
313fd8bd86f8342300c9fd7fa40ea181d53ea06c9ddf7f35b2c936f34c74ef3b
spent
true